Governor Terry Branstad Iowa State Fair Scholarship
If a high school student has been highly involved in the Iowa State Fair then he/she is eligible to apply for the Governor Terry Branstad Iowa State Fair Scholarship. The scholarship is awarded to students with exceptional academic achievements. The students eligible for this scholarship must be high school seniors who are enrolled in high schools located in the state of Iowa. The applicants must also be willing to enroll themselves in colleges or universities in Iowa.
The scholarship is awarded to 4 students every year and the award amount ranges between $500 and $1,000. The deadline for this scholarship is April 1 and students can apply separately for this scholarship.
Iowa Grant
The Iowa Grant awards up to $1,000 to undergraduate students who have demonstrated a serious financial need in their FAFSA forms. The grant is renewable every year up to four years. The grant is open to students who wish to enroll themselves in independent colleges and universities, regent universities and community colleges located in the state of Iowa. The chosen applicants are notified through the financial aid offices of the respective universities.

Robert C. Byrd Honors Scholarships
The Robert C. Byrd Honors Scholarships is a highly selective scholarship and is open to students to have a consistent GPA of 3.5 or higher in high school as well as top ACT or SAT scores. The eligible students should have been accepted into an Iowa state college or university. The applicants must be high achievement students academically and personally. Iowa Tuition Grant
The Iowa Tuition Grant is given to students already enrolled in Iowa state approved private colleges or universities. Students with serious financial need are given maximum priority. The grant awards scholarships up to $4,000 every year. The award amount may vary depending on the funds available. The chosen applicants should be enrolled in full-time courses though the program is also open to part-time students who will receive adjusted amounts. The grant is renewable every year up to four years. Students are automatically considered for this scholarship when they display a financial need in their FAFSA forms.
Robert D. Blue Scholarship
The Robert D. Blue Scholarship, named after the former governor of the state of Iowa awards $500-$1,000 to students with exceptional scholastic and literary skills. Eligible students can be high school seniors or students already enrolled in the Iowa state colleges or universities. The deadline is May 10 and the application must be submitted along with a 500 word essay.
